Chip detectors in aircraft lubrication systems come in two types: an electrical detector and a magnetic detector. The electrical type uses metal particles that accumulate and bridge a gap between two contacts, completing a circuit and sending a cockpit warning when wear is detected. This provides an immediate in-flight alert to potential engine damage. The magnetic type, on the other hand, collects metal particles without closing a circuit or sending a signal; it relies on maintenance to inspect or remove the detector element and assess wear during scheduled checks. It isn’t a filter for the oil.
